The Gandhinagar Municipal Corporation has issued a comprehensive tender for the Supply, Installation, Testing, and O&M of an Adaptive Traffic Control System (ATCS) and Traffic Enforcement System (TES). This project aims to modernize traffic management across Gandhinagar city, leveraging cutting-edge intelligent transportation systems to improve traffic flow, safety, and enforcement. The tender invites experienced agencies with proven expertise in ITS deployment, hardware and software integration, and municipal infrastructure projects. The scope includes system supply, installation, testing, commissioning, and ongoing maintenance, with a focus on compliance with national standards and seamless integration with existing traffic systems. The project deadline for bid submission is March 3, 2026, with evaluation and award processes following. Bidders must meet eligibility criteria, submit all supporting documents, and adhere to technical and financial guidelines. This is a strategic opportunity for companies specializing in smart city traffic solutions to contribute to Gandhinagar’s urban development and smart city initiatives.

Scope Of Work

The selected agency will be responsible for:

  • Supply of all hardware and software components for the Adaptive Traffic Control System (ATCS) and Traffic Enforcement System (TES).
  • Installation and commissioning of the systems at designated traffic junctions.
  • Testing and validation to ensure operational efficiency.
  • Training of municipal personnel for system management.
  • Ongoing operation and maintenance (O&M) for a specified period.

The process involves:

  1. Delivery of equipment as per specifications.
  2. Installation at identified traffic junctions.
  3. System testing and troubleshooting.
  4. Commissioning after successful testing.
  5. Training and handover to municipal authorities.

How will the evaluation of bids be conducted?

Bids will be scored based on technical competence (50%), financial offer (30%), and past experience (20%). Minimum thresholds include a technical score of 70/100. Evaluation factors include system quality, project approach, compliance, and cost-effectiveness, ensuring the selection of the most capable and value-driven agency.
